# Approvals — Graphlet Visualizer

Quick rules for on-call: config-only changes to the Graphlet dependency graph visualizer can ship with one peer thumbs-up. Anything touching the layout engine or the cycle detector needs a full approval in the review queue — no exceptions, even at 3am. Hotfixes still get a retroactive review next business day. Escalations and final approval authority sit with the person named below.

named custodian: Brivan Eliath Quenox Frador

For the Cartwheel catalog service, cache invalidation is driven by change events from the Merchant Hub rather than TTL expiry alone. Each product mutation publishes a versioned key; edge caches compare versions and evict stale entries within one propagation window. TTLs remain as a safety net for missed events, and we deliberately keep them short on price fields but longer on descriptions. Negative caching is capped to avoid masking new SKUs. The tuning constants that control these windows and caps are as follows.

tuning constants:
QUOTAS = {
    "druwyn": 5,
    "holix": 5,
    "zorath": 5,
    "holwyn": 10,
}

Hiring Freeze — Fieldworks Division (Managers Only)

Effective immediately, all open requisitions in the Fieldworks Division at Tarnow Group are frozen. Backfills require CEO approval. Contractors already engaged may complete current terms; no extensions. Offers issued before the freeze date will be honored. Review at next board session. No external communication until cleared by Corporate Affairs. The underlying plan is summarized in the note below.

internal memo for hahif-hahaf: Headcount on the Zorwyn team goes from 9 to 100 by the end of October. Gross margin on Zorwyn came in at 5 percent against a plan of 10 percent.

## Local Setup — Barcode Scanner Integration

The Shelfhound scanner bridge listens on a local socket and translates scans into inventory events. Install the bridge with `make bridge`, then plug in any HID-mode scanner. Test scans appear in the dev console under the `scan.raw` topic. The bridge persists scan history to the inventory database, so configure it with the connection string that follows.

primary connection of tawif-yajeg = postgresql://rusiel_svc:G879q9cx6GsSvj@db-dd9f.norvagrid.internal:5432/casath